Peer reviewedJayasinghe, Upali W.; Marsh, Herbert W.; Bond, Nigel – Educational Evaluation and Policy Analysis, 2001
Evaluated the peer review process used to fund Australian university research across all disciplines, relating peer reviews of 2,989 research proposals (6,233 external reviewers) to characteristics of the researchers and of reviewers. Findings lead to suggestions for improvement, especially that researcher-nominated reviewers should not be used…

McIntire, Todd – Technology & Learning, 2004
The past four years have seen a precipitous decline in funding for school technology programs. According to Quality Education Data, spending on instructional technology peaked at $8.36 billion in the 1998-99 school year, falling by more than half a billion dollars each year for the next four years to $5.74 billion.
